Heat Shrink Boots, Caps

Heat shrink is a device used in cable and wire management. It is created from a material specifically designed to shrink to a predefined ratio to form a tight, seamless bond around wires and cables. Boots and caps are particularly designed to fit over the wire and connector terminals to help secure the connection or to cap off and protect wires or cables. To select the proper boot or cap, you need the shell size, supplied diameter, and recovered diameter. Other defining properties are the color, type, and length. These have many special feature options such as: abrasion resistant, adhesive coating, chemical resistant, fluid resistant, heat resistant, strain resistant, flame retardant, etc.
